5. Among us 🔍
Trust no one… or maybe just your most suspicious coworker! Among Us is one of the most popular online games that is a perfect mix of strategy, deception, and humor.
In the game, players take on roles as Crewmates or Impostors aboard a spaceship. The Crewmates must complete tasks while the Impostors secretly sabotage their mission.
The real fun? Figuring out who’s lying before they eliminate everyone!
🛸 Fun Fact: Among Us was almost a flop! Released in 2018, the game had so few players that the developers considered shutting it down. Then 2020 hit, everyone was stuck at home, and streamers turned it into a worldwide obsession. Who knew accusing your friends of being “sus” would bring us all together?

18. Spyfall online 🕶️
Spyfall is a thrilling online detective game that challenges players to uncover the hidden imposter before time runs out. It’s part strategy, part deception, and all fun.
Each player (except one) is given the same secret location. One player, however, is the spy and has no clue where they are. Non-spy players ask clever questions to confirm they know the location, while the spy tries to figure it out before getting caught.
You can use spyfall.app or similar online versions. Just be careful who you trust! 😆

21. The whisper challenge 🤫
Here’s one of the funniest team-building games online. The whisper challenge is a game of lip-reading, wild guesses, and uncontrollable laughter.
One player wears noise-canceling headphones (or plays loud music) while another teammate says a phrase on the video call. The person with headphones must read their teammate’s lips and guess the phrase.
Sounds easy? Just wait until “Let’s finalize the report” turns into “Let’s find a lizard fort.”

23. Remote bingo 🎟️
Remote Bingo adds a hilarious twist to virtual meetings by turning common remote work moments into a fun competition.
Before the game, create a bingo card with common remote work moments like someone saying “Can you hear me?”, a pet popping up on screen, or someone forgetting to unmute.
During your video call, players mark off squares as they happen. The first to complete a row, column, or full card shouts “BINGO!” and wins a fun prize.
